一種高爾夫球場自動記桿系統(tǒng)和方法
【技術(shù)領(lǐng)域】
[0001]本發(fā)明涉及一種高爾夫球場自動記桿系統(tǒng)和方法。
【背景技術(shù)】
[0002]現(xiàn)在高爾夫比賽時,都是采用人工記桿的方式,現(xiàn)場的比賽成績只有當前球洞周邊的人才能看到,其余球洞的球手或場外觀眾無法實時看到現(xiàn)場的比賽成績。在球場擊球時,每一桿的準確擊球距離也無法實時得到。
【發(fā)明內(nèi)容】
[0003]本發(fā)明的目的在于提供一種高爾夫球場自動記桿系統(tǒng)和方法,自動采集擊球地點信息、所用球桿信息、擊球距離、是否完成擊球和匹配出球手信息,并實時發(fā)布給球手或場外觀眾,方便其余球洞的球手或場外觀眾實時看到現(xiàn)場的比賽成績,也方便球手對自己使用不同類型球桿擊球狀況進行進一步掌握和記錄。
[0004]本發(fā)明一種高爾夫自動記桿系統(tǒng),包括球場數(shù)據(jù)平臺、多個擊球采集單元,不同類型的球桿對應(yīng)不同類型的擊球采集單元;
所述的球場數(shù)據(jù)平臺,用于接收各擊球采集單元上傳的信息,使用時,在球場數(shù)據(jù)平臺數(shù)據(jù)庫中,事先將擊球采集單元ID與使用的球手ID進行綁定,將根據(jù)連續(xù)的前后兩次擊球動作完成時GPS模塊獲得的位置數(shù)據(jù)計算出距離值,作為上一次的擊球距離;將擊球位置、擊球時間、擊球距離、球桿類型和匹配的球手信息通過互聯(lián)網(wǎng)或無線通信網(wǎng)絡(luò)實時發(fā)布到相關(guān)用戶端,與球場地圖結(jié)合直觀地展示給用戶;
該擊球采集單元設(shè)于高爾夫球桿握把頂端,包括GPS模塊、動作判斷模塊、加速度傳感器、處理器和無線通信模塊,其中GPS模塊實時采集球手當前位置信息給處理器,并經(jīng)由無線通信模塊上傳至球場數(shù)據(jù)平臺;該動作判斷模塊根據(jù)加速度傳感器的數(shù)據(jù)判斷球手擊球動作是否完成,一旦判斷擊球動作完成,則將擊球完成信號發(fā)送給處理器,處理器將擊球完成信號或者依照擊球完成信號的產(chǎn)生時間形成的球手完成擊球的時間信息、該球手當前的位置信息和擊球采集單元ID,通過無線通信模塊上傳至球場數(shù)據(jù)平臺。
[0005]所述的擊球采集單元由球手主機和擊球采集器組成;其中
球手主機由GPS模塊、處理器、近場通信模塊和無線通信模塊組成,使用時,在球場數(shù)據(jù)平臺數(shù)據(jù)庫中,將球手主機ID與使用的球手ID進行綁定,將球手主機佩帶于球手身上,該GPS模塊實時采集球手的當前位置信息發(fā)送給處理器,并通過無線通信模塊上傳至球場數(shù)據(jù)平臺;該近場通信模塊在球手主機與擊球采集器靠近時,啟動配對動作,配對完成時,球手主機根據(jù)配對信息獲取該球手當前所使用的球桿信息;當球手主機接收到擊球采集器發(fā)送的擊球完成信號后,依照當前時間形成球手完成擊球的時間信息,會同該球手的當前位置信息和球手主機ID通過無線通信模塊上傳至球場數(shù)據(jù)平臺;球場數(shù)據(jù)平臺或者球手主機根據(jù)兩次擊球動作完成時GPS模塊獲得的位置數(shù)據(jù)計算出的距離值,作為上一次的擊球距離; 所述的擊球采集器設(shè)于高爾夫球桿握把頂端,由近場通信模塊、動作判斷模塊和加速度傳感器組成,當擊球采集器靠近球手佩帶的球手主機時,啟動配對動作;當球手開始擊球動作時,該動作判斷模塊根據(jù)加速度傳感器的數(shù)據(jù)判斷球手擊球動作是否完成,一旦判斷擊球動作完成,立即發(fā)送擊球完成信號給球手主機。
[0006]進一步,還設(shè)有以使球場形成無通信死角的無線通信網(wǎng)絡(luò)的多個球場無線接入設(shè)備,所述的球場無線接入設(shè)備布設(shè)在球場上,負責(zé)球場數(shù)據(jù)平臺和擊球采集單元或者球手主機之間的數(shù)據(jù)交互。
[0007]—種高爾夫自動記桿系統(tǒng)的記桿方法,包括如下步驟:
步驟1、在球場數(shù)據(jù)平臺數(shù)據(jù)庫中,將球手所使用的所有擊球采集單元ID與使用的球手ID進彳丁綁定;
步驟2、在球手不同類型的球桿上裝設(shè)對應(yīng)的擊球采集單元;
步驟3、擊球采集單元實時向球場數(shù)據(jù)平臺上傳由GPS模塊采集球手的當前位置信息及擊球采集器ID,該球場數(shù)據(jù)平臺根據(jù)擊球采集器ID獲得球手信息以及球手使用的當前球桿信息;
步驟4、球桿在未被使用時,擊球采集單元處于休眠省電模式,當球手拿起球桿,若達到加速度傳感器的觸發(fā)值,則從休眠省電模式轉(zhuǎn)為工作模式,當球手開始擊球動作時,該動作判斷模塊根據(jù)加速度傳感器的數(shù)據(jù)判斷球手擊球動作是否完成,一旦判斷擊球動作完成,則將擊球完成信號或者依照擊球完成信號的產(chǎn)生時間形成的球手完成擊球的時間信息、該球手當前的位置信息和擊球采集單元ID通過無線通信模塊上傳至球場數(shù)據(jù)平臺;
步驟5、球場數(shù)據(jù)平臺接收各擊球采集單元上傳的信息,并將擊球位置、擊球時間、擊球距離、球桿類型和匹配出的球手信息通過互聯(lián)網(wǎng)或無線通信網(wǎng)絡(luò)發(fā)布到相關(guān)用戶端,與球場地圖結(jié)合直觀地呈現(xiàn)給使用者。
[0008]所述的擊球采集單元由球手主機和擊球采集器組成的高爾夫自動記桿系統(tǒng)的記桿方法,包括如下步驟:
步驟1、在球場數(shù)據(jù)平臺數(shù)據(jù)庫中,將球手主機ID與使用的球手ID進行綁定,讓該球手佩帶球手主機;
步驟2、在球手不同類型的球桿上裝設(shè)對應(yīng)的擊球采集器;
步驟3、球手佩帶的球手主機實時向球場數(shù)據(jù)平臺上傳由GPS模塊采集的球手當前位置信息及球手主機ID,球場數(shù)據(jù)平臺根據(jù)球手主機ID獲得球手信息;
步驟4、球桿在未被使用時,擊球采集器處于休眠省電模式,當球手拿起球桿,若達到加速度傳感器的觸發(fā)值,則從休眠省電模式轉(zhuǎn)為工作模式,當擊球采集器靠近球手佩帶的球手主機時,啟動配對動作,此時球手主機通過配對信息獲取該球手當前所使用的球桿信息,當球手開始擊球動作時,該動作判斷模塊根據(jù)加速度傳感器的數(shù)據(jù)判斷球手擊球動作是否完成,一旦動作判斷模塊判斷擊球動作完成,立即發(fā)送擊球完成信號給球手主機;
步驟5、當球手主機接收到擊球采集器發(fā)送的擊球完成信號后,依照當前時間形成球手完成擊球的時間信息,會同該球手當前的位置信息和球手主機ID上傳至球場數(shù)據(jù)平臺;步驟6、球場數(shù)據(jù)平臺接收各球手主機上傳的信息,并將擊球位置、擊球時間、擊球距離、球桿類型和匹配出的球手信息通過互聯(lián)網(wǎng)或無線通信網(wǎng)絡(luò)發(fā)布到相關(guān)用戶端,與球場地圖結(jié)合直觀地呈現(xiàn)給使用者。
[0009]由于本發(fā)明將擊球采集單元或擊球采集器裝設(shè)于高爾夫球桿握把頂端,利用其中的加速度傳感器和動作判斷模塊來自動判斷球手是否完成擊球動作,同時將擊球位置、擊球時間、擊球距離、球桿類型和匹配出的球手信息通過互聯(lián)網(wǎng)或無線通信網(wǎng)絡(luò)發(fā)布到相關(guān)用戶端,與球場地圖結(jié)合直觀地呈現(xiàn)給使用者,不僅方便球手對自己使用不同類型球桿擊球狀況進行進一步掌握,也方便其余球洞的球手或場外觀眾及時跟蹤和了解比賽信息。
【附圖說明】
[0010]圖1為本發(fā)明一種高爾夫自動記桿系統(tǒng)的工作原理圖;
圖2為本發(fā)明球手主機的結(jié)構(gòu)示意圖;
圖3為本發(fā)明擊球采集器的結(jié)構(gòu)示意圖;
圖4為本發(fā)明擊球采集單元的結(jié)構(gòu)示意圖。
[0011]以下結(jié)合附圖和具體實施例對本發(fā)明作進一步詳述。
【具體實施方式】
[0012]本發(fā)明一種高爾夫自動記桿系統(tǒng)具有多種實施例,如圖1所不,為實施例一,主要包括球場數(shù)據(jù)平臺1、多個球場無線接入設(shè)備2、多個球手主機3、多個擊球采集器4,不同類型的球桿對應(yīng)不同類型的擊球采集器4 ;
所述的球場數(shù)據(jù)平臺1,用于接收各球手主機3經(jīng)由球場無線接入設(shè)備2上傳的信息,并將擊球位置、擊球時間、擊球距離、球桿類型和匹配出的球手信息通過互聯(lián)網(wǎng)或無線通信網(wǎng)絡(luò)進行發(fā)布,例如,可通過互聯(lián)網(wǎng)發(fā)布到相關(guān)用戶的app上,或者通過球場無線通信網(wǎng)絡(luò)發(fā)布到球手主機3上,與球場地圖結(jié)合直觀地展示給用戶,方便球手對自己使用不同類型球桿擊球狀況進行進一步掌握,也方便其余球洞的球手或場外觀眾及時跟蹤和了解比賽信息;
所述的球場無線接入設(shè)備2布設(shè)在球場上,以使球場形成無通信死角的無線通信網(wǎng)絡(luò),負責(zé)球場數(shù)據(jù)平臺I和球手主機3之間的信息交互;該球場無線接入設(shè)備2不是必要設(shè)備,當球手主機3為用戶的手機裝設(shè)有S頂卡時,球手主機3可以通過當前3G或4G通訊網(wǎng)絡(luò)與球場數(shù)據(jù)平臺I數(shù)據(jù)交互;
如圖2所示,所述的球手主機3由GPS模塊31、處理器32、近場通信模塊33和無線通信模塊34組成,使用時,在球場數(shù)據(jù)平臺I數(shù)據(jù)庫中,將球手主機ID與使用的球手ID進行綁定,并佩帶于球手身上,該GPS模塊31實時采集球手的位置信息發(fā)送給處理器32,并經(jīng)由無線通信模塊34上傳至球場數(shù)據(jù)平臺I ;該近場通信模塊33可以是低功耗藍牙模塊、射頻模塊或者Zigbee模塊,當球手主機3與擊球采集器4靠近時,啟動配對動作,配對完成時,球手主機3根據(jù)配對信息獲取該球手當前所使用的球桿信息;當球手主機3接收到擊球采集器4發(fā)送的擊球完成信號后,依照當前時間形成球手完成擊球的時間信息,會同該球手當前的位置信息和球手主機ID等信息,通過無線通信模塊34經(jīng)由球場無線接入設(shè)備2上傳至球場數(shù)據(jù)平臺I ;該無線通信模塊34也可以是當前3G或4G通信模塊;球場數(shù)據(jù)平臺I或者球手主機3的處理器32根據(jù)兩次擊球動作完成時GPS模塊31獲得的位置數(shù)據(jù),計算出的距離作為上一次的擊球距離;
如圖3所示,所述的擊球采集器4設(shè)于高爾夫球桿握把頂端,由近場通信模塊41、動作判斷模塊42和加速度傳感器43組成,其中動作判斷模塊42和加速度傳感器43可以集成一塊元器件;由于不同球桿的擊球動作存在明顯的差異,有的需要揮桿,有的只需要推桿,因此,不同類型的擊球采集器4的動作判斷模塊42只能判斷對應(yīng)球桿的擊球動作;當球桿靜止時,該加速度傳感器43進入休眠省電模式,一旦球手拿起球桿,加速度傳感器43對采集的數(shù)據(jù)進行判斷,若達到觸發(fā)值,則從休眠省電模式轉(zhuǎn)為工作模式,同時,由于擊球采集器42靠近球手佩帶的球手主機3,啟動配對動作;當球手開始擊球動作時,動作判斷模塊42根據(jù)加速度傳感器43的數(shù)據(jù)判斷擊球動作是否完成,一旦判斷擊球動作完成立即發(fā)送擊球完成信號給球手主機3。
[0013]本發(fā)明基于高爾夫自動記桿系統(tǒng)實施例一的自動記桿方法,包括如下步驟:
步驟1、在球場數(shù)據(jù)平臺I數(shù)據(jù)庫中,將球手主機ID與使用的球手ID進行綁定,讓該球手佩帶球手主機3 ;
步驟2、在球手不同類型的球桿上裝設(shè)對應(yīng)的擊球采集器4 ;
步驟3、球手佩帶的球手主機3經(jīng)由球場無線接入設(shè)備2向球場數(shù)據(jù)